Mac Jones dynasty trades

Mac Jones has changed hands in 1,254 real dynasty trades.

These are completed deals from public Sleeper leagues, not hypotheticals and not calculator output. Each one is graded at the player values that were current on the day it happened, so you can see what he actually costs rather than what a calculator says he should.

Across all 1,254 of them the value gap runs -19.9%, which is in favour of the side giving him up.
